Stages of Date Fruit Ripening
Date fruits develop through several distinct ripening stages, each characterized by specific color changes and textural transformations. The most prominent stages are as follows:
1. Kimri Stage
Kimri is the initial stage of ripening, signaled by small, green fruits. During this period, the dates are firm and acquire their characteristic flavor, but they are not yet sweet.
2. Khalal Stage
Once the fruits start to turn yellow or red, they enter the Khalal stage. At this stage, the dates become softer, but still retain their firm texture. This is a crucial period as the dates begin to develop their distinctive color and texture.
3. Rutab Stage
During the Rutab stage, the dates deepen in color to a rich brown and become even softer. This stage marks the beginning of the sweetening process, and the fruity aroma becomes more pronounced.
4. Tamar Stage
This is the final stage of ripening, where the dates are fully mature and sweet. They have achieved their highest sugar content and are ready for consumption. Tamar dates are characterized by their deep brown color and soft, fleshy texture.
Challenges and Factors Affecting Ripening
The natural ripening process of date fruits on the tree can be slow and is influenced by a variety of factors. Challenges arise due to variations in environmental conditions, which can delay the ripening process. The following are key factors that influence date fruit ripening:
1. Temperature
Optimum temperature is crucial for optimal ripening. Higher temperatures can accelerate ripening, while lower temperatures can slow it down.
2. Humidity
Proper humidity levels are necessary to maintain the moisture content of the fruits. High humidity can lead to rapid spoilage, while low humidity can dry out the fruits.
3. Care and Management Practices
Proper care and management practices, such as fertilization, watering, and pruning, significantly impact the ripening process. These practices ensure that the date palms receive the necessary nutrients and resources to produce healthy and well-ripened fruits.
Artificial Acceleration of Ripening
While the natural ripening process can be enhanced through proper care and management, it is often beneficial to accelerate the ripening process for faster growth and higher yields. This can be achieved through a combination of techniques:
1. Controlled Environment Systems
By using controlled environment systems, farmers can regulate temperature and humidity to mimic favorable conditions for optimal ripening. These systems can accelerate the ripening process without compromising fruit quality.
2. Hormonal Treatments
Hormonal treatments, such as auxins and ethylene regulators, can be applied to accelerate ripening. These hormones promote cell expansion and facilitate the softening process, leading to faster ripening.
3. Genetic Modification
Through genetic modification, scientists can introduce genes that enhance ripening processes, resulting in faster and more uniform fruit ripening. This technique can also improve fruit quality and yield.
